The striations, Continue reading.The muscles all begin the actual process of contracting (shortening) when a protein called actin is pulled by a protein called myosin. This occurs in striated muscle (skeletal and cardiac) after specific binding sites on the actin have been exposed in response to the interaction between calcium ions (Ca ++) and proteins (troponin and tropomyosin) that "shield" the actin-binding sites.

Because skeletal muscle cells are long and cylindrical, they are commonly referred to as muscle fibers. Skeletal muscle fibers can be quite large for human cells, with diameters up to 100 μm and lengths up to 30 cm (11.8 in) in the Sartorius of the upper leg.During early development, embryonic myoblasts, each with its own nucleus, fuse with up to hundreds of other ...Striated muscle structure and function. Type of muscle: poorly developed SR. smooth muscle, stores only some calcium.Both cardiac and skeletal muscle tissues exhibit a striated appearance under a microscope. This striation is due to the arrangement of sarcomeres, which contain actin and myosin filaments, arranged in parallel, involved in muscle contraction.In contrast, smooth muscle tissue does not display striations and has a different structure and function.
